Curves in $\mathbb{R}^4$ and two-rich points (1512.05648v2)
Published 17 Dec 2015 in math.CO and cs.CG
Abstract: We obtain a new bound on the number of two-rich points spanned by an arrangement of low degree algebraic curves in $\mathbb{R}4$. Specifically, we show that an arrangement of $n$ algebraic curves determines at most $C_\epsilon n{4/3+3\epsilon}$ two-rich points, provided at most $n{2/3+2\epsilon}$ curves lie in any low degree hypersurface and at most $n{1/3+\epsilon}$ curves lie in any low degree surface. This result follows from a structure theorem about arrangements of curves that determine many two-rich points.
